An overview of the experience

This tour captures the essence of a peaceful evening at sea. Starting from the pier of Golfo Aranci, we head toward the impressive Figarolo Island, floating between Capo Figari and the Gulf of Aranci. The entire trip is designed to be a relaxed, sensory experience—you’ll feel the gentle breeze, see the changing colors of the sky, and hear the soft lapping of the water.
The journey begins at the floating dock just after the Golfo Aranci harbor (coordinates 40.99818801879883, 9.622663497924805). From here, the boat sets off on a scenic tour around the island, with the guide providing insights about local landmarks and the natural environment. The route includes a scenic sightseeing segment, giving you a good overview of the coast and the island’s features.

Dolphin sightings: a delightful surprise

One of the most loved aspects of this tour is the chance to spot bottlenose dolphins. They swim freely in the waters around Capo Figari, Cala Moresca, and Figarolo Island. While sightings are not guaranteed, reviews suggest that many travelers do see dolphins during the tour, adding that extra layer of magic to an already beautiful experience.
Our guide explains how dolphins frequent these waters, making it an educational moment as well. Watching these intelligent creatures glide through the water against the backdrop of a setting sun is truly memorable.

Frequently Asked Questions
Is this tour suitable for children?
It’s best suited for older children and adults. The tour involves being on a boat for two hours and is not designed specifically for families with very young kids or babies, especially since baby strollers and large bags aren’t allowed onboard.
Can I see dolphins during the tour?
Yes, many travelers report dolphin sightings, especially around Capo Figari, Cala Moresca, and Figarolo Island. While sightings aren’t guaranteed, the guide will point out any dolphins if they’re around.
What should I bring?
Bring a towel, beachwear, and a sense of patience for the sunset views. Also, a passport or ID is needed for check-in. Avoid bringing large luggage, baby strollers, or heavy bags.
How long is the tour?
The entire experience lasts about two hours, including sightseeing, the sunset aperitif, and the swim stop.
Is the tour offered in multiple languages?
Yes, guides speak English, Spanish, and Italian, making it accessible for many travelers.
Can I cancel if my plans change?
Yes, you can cancel up to 24 hours in advance for a full refund, offering some flexibility if your plans shift.
Where exactly does the tour start?
The meeting point is at the floating dock just after the Golfo Aranci harbor, at coordinates 40.998188, 9.622663.
Is alcohol served during the aperitif?
Yes, local beverages are part of the aperitif, making it a relaxed and enjoyable moment.
Is this tour suitable for people with mobility issues?
No, it’s not recommended for those with mobility problems, as the boat ride and walk-in stops may be challenging.
What’s the weather like?
The tour is weather-dependent. If conditions are rough or stormy, the trip might be canceled or rescheduled.
